What does Omdev mean?

The name Omdev is derived from the Sanskrit word ‘Om’ which represents the supreme deity and the sound of the universe. The suffix ‘dev’ means God or deity. The name signifies devotion and surrender to Lord Om.

Spiritual & cultural context

A constant reminder of one's devotion to the divine.

The syllable 'Om' is a significant mantra in Hinduism that represents the creation, preservation, and destruction of the universe. It is ubiquitous in Hindu religious practices and is often used to signify the beginning and end of rituals. The name Omdev may be used to invoke the blessings of Lord Om, emphasizing the connection between the Hindu spiritual Tradition and the individual.
